Medrad Continuum MR Infusion system- non-wireless system The MEDRAD Continuum MR Infusion System is designed for patients who require medications and other fluids during an MR procedure. It is intended to provide infusion therapy directly prior to, during and immediately after the MR procedure functioning while either stationary or mobile. It is not intended to provide long-term patient care outside the MR environment. The system is to be used by trained medical staff, primarily critical care, emergency room and radiology nursing staff.
